Six_stars_4The most interesting thing in today’s newspapers dining sections is not editorial. And it’s not available online. It’s an advertisement, a full column, running down the right-side of the restaurant review page in the New York Times. Presumably purchased by Alan and Michael Stillman of the Smith & Wolensky Restaurant Group, it congratulates Danny Meyer on his unprecedented six-stars last week. It’s pretty breathtaking. I’ve never seen anything like before. I asked Danny what he thought about it? To which he replied

"I was blown away when I saw the ad this morning.  I called Alan and Michael as soon as I got in to work and told them that! The Stillmans’ magnanimous gesture is at least as unprecedented as were the twin NYT three-star reviews for Eleven Madison Park and The Modern. It’s a rare industry where competitors are so gracious to one another, and it’s one more reason I can’t imagine working anywhere other than the hospitality business in New York."
